> Bookie can fail to recover if index pages flushed before ledger flush 
> acknowledged

> Bookie index page steal (LedgerCacheImpl::grabCleanPage) can cause index file 
> to reflect unacknowledged entries (due to flushLedger). Suppose ledger and 
> entry fail to flush due to Bookkeeper server crash, it will cause ledger 
> recovery not able to use the bookie afterward, due to 
> InterleavedStorageLedger::getEntry throws IOException.
> If the ackSet bookies all experience this problem (DC environment), the 
> ledger will not be able to recover.
> The problem here essentially a violation of WAL. One reasonable fix is to 
> track ledger flush progress (either per-ledger entry, or per-topic message). 
> Do not flush index pages which tracks entries whose ledger (log) has not been 
> flushed.
